| PF01973 | 6-hydroxymethylpterin diphosphokinase MptE-like | family |
This domain can be found in a group of proteins, including archaeal 6-hydroxymethylpterin diphosphokinase (6-HMDPK), known as MptE, which catalyses the formation of 6-hydroxymethyl-7,8-dihydropterin diphosphate (6-HMDP) from 6-HMD and ATP [1]. 6-HMDP is the precursor of the pterin containing moiety of the essential C1-carriers tetrahydrofolate and tetrahydromethanopterin. This entry also includes a number of uncharacterised proteins from bacteria.
